The Wavegarden Experience

Wavegarden’s technology allows for consistent, high-quality waves in controlled environments. This innovation caters not only to professional surfers but also to beginners looking to hone their skills. With facilities located across the globe, from Spain to Australia, Wavegarden offers a variety of wave types to suit every level of experience.

Accessibility for All

One of the most notable contributions of Wavegarden is the democratization of surfing. Traditional surfing relies heavily on natural ocean waves, making the sport inaccessible for many. With Wavegarden’s controlled environments, surfers can practice anytime, regardless of weather conditions or ocean tides. This accessibility encourages more people to engage with the sport, fostering a greater sense of community and camaraderie among water sports enthusiasts.

Training Ground for Professionals

Another significant benefit of Wavegarden is its potential as a training ground for aspiring professional surfers. The predictability of artificial waves allows athletes to refine their techniques and skills in a controlled setting, which is invaluable when preparing for competitive events. Moreover, coaches can use video analysis and other tools to offer real-time feedback, further enhancing the training experience.
